1 of 4 / Platforms: The 2024 Tech Strategy Toolkit

Useful post by Sangeet Paul Choudary if you want to better understand the intersection space between Tech and Strategy.

"Every company is not necessarily a tech company. But all strategy involves tech strategy.(...) technology plays an ever-increasing role in your ability to build and sustain competitive advantage.(…) this post lays out nine different forms of tech-driven advantage.

1. The interface advantage

2. The cross-subsidization advantage

3. The brand integration advantage

4. The vertical integration advantage

5. The unbundling advantage

6. The composability advantage

7. The interoperability advantage

8. The community advantage

And most important...

9. The rebundling advantage”

3 of 4 / A Smart Bear: What makes a strategy great

Jason Cohen synthesises 6 characteristics:

  • ”Simple: Reshapes complexity to be manageable and actionable.
  • Candid: Dares to spotlight the most difficult truths.
  • Decisive: Asserts clear decisions and accepts their consequences.
  • Leveraged: Magnifies strengths into durable competitive advantage.
  • Asymmetric: Defeats uncertainty with higher upside than downside.
  • Futuristic: Solves for the long-term.”

Enjoyed the points about asymmetry the most, especially:

”A sign of a bad strategy is when success requires everything to go right. With a set of asymmetric bets, the successes render the failures moot, and so the unpredictable waves crashing into the boat still result in forward motion.”

Matching team size to task ??

Spotted a useful idea in ”The Social Brain: The Psychology of Successful Groups" book, by authors Tracey Camilleri, Samantha Rockey and Robin Dunbar:

”Different kinds of task need to be carefully matched to group size. Failure to do so will inevitably result in inefficiencies that make the group's decision-making processes less effective.

4 people - Conversation Groups No outcome needed, discussion in the moment, everyone is involved

5 people - Fast decision-making group No facilitation needed to arrive at an outcome, no hierarchy, equal share of voice

6-12 people - Work group Facilitation needed, outcomes clear, agenda needed, processes defined, each person has defined role, each person has a share of voice (unlikely to be equal due to time constraints)

12-15 people - Complex decision-making group Facilitation or chairing, multiple perspectives encouraged to arrive at a better decision, each person to be allocated a share of voice and point of view, more formal process and agenda needed

50 people - Information sharing and sub-group work Strong facilitation, clear agenda, outcomes defined

150 people - Town Hall, information sharing and sub-group work Clear 'front of room' and facilitation needed, clear agenda and outcomes needed”

Notice how facilitation is needed for groups of 6+ people.
